SENATE CONCURRENT RESOLUTION
 1-1           WHEREAS, Senate Bill No. 525 has passed the Texas Senate and
 1-2     the Texas House of Representatives and is now in the office of the
 1-3     governor; and
 1-4           WHEREAS, Further consideration of the bill by the senate and
 1-5     the house of representatives is necessary; now, therefore, be it
 1-6           RESOLVED by the 76th Legislature, That the governor be hereby
 1-7     requested to return Senate Bill No. 525 to the senate for further
 1-8     consideration; and, be it further
 1-9           RESOLVED, That the action of the President of the Senate and
1-10     the Speaker of the House in signing Senate Bill No. 525 be declared
1-11     null and void and that the two presiding officers be authorized to
1-12     remove their signatures from the enrolled bill.
